Ralitta: Elegant Handwritten Font for Real Projects

Ralitta isn’t just another script font—it’s a carefully balanced blend of warmth and precision. Its smooth, confident strokes flow naturally without sacrificing legibility. Letters connect with subtle intention, not forced automation. There are no exaggerated flourishes that distract or obscure meaning—just graceful rhythm, consistent spacing, and quiet confidence. That’s why designers, small business owners, educators, and creators consistently reach for Ralitta when they need handwriting that feels human, intentional, and trustworthy.

Why Ralitta Works Where Other Scripts Fall Short

Many handwritten fonts lean too far in one direction: either overly casual (hard to read at smaller sizes) or rigidly formal (losing the charm of real pen-on-paper). Ralitta avoids both pitfalls. Its x-height is generous, its ascenders and descenders are clear but restrained, and its letterforms maintain visual harmony across uppercase, lowercase, and punctuation. It performs well at 12 pt on thank-you cards and scales beautifully up to 60 pt for wedding signage.

This balance makes Ralitta especially useful for audiences who value authenticity *and* clarity—think educators printing classroom quotes, freelancers designing client logos, or small-batch stationery makers crafting wedding suites. It doesn’t ask viewers to work to understand it. Instead, it invites them in—softly, confidently, without pretense.

Styling Tips That Keep Ralitta Effective

Even elegant fonts can lose impact if misused. Here’s what works—and what to avoid:

Do use light tracking (letter-spacing) for headlines. Slightly opening up the space between letters prevents visual crowding, especially at larger sizes. Try +10–+20 units in design software—not more.

Do pair with neutral, highly legible typefaces. Ralitta thrives alongside geometric sans-serifs (e.g., Montserrat), humanist sans-serifs (e.g., Open Sans), or even low-contrast serifs (e.g., PT Serif). Avoid competing scripts or high-contrast display fonts—they’ll muddy hierarchy.

Don’t stretch or distort Ralitta. Its charm lives in proportion. Scaling width or height independently breaks stroke consistency and undermines its handwritten integrity.

Don’t set body text in Ralitta. Even at optimal size, extended reading in script reduces comprehension and increases fatigue. Reserve it for headings, names, short phrases, or decorative accents—never paragraphs.

Adapting Ralitta Across Platforms and Formats

How you use Ralitta changes depending on context—not just aesthetics, but function and audience expectations.

For digital use, test Ralitta in email headers, social media quote graphics, or website hero sections. Export as SVG for crisp rendering at any size, or embed via @font-face with fallbacks. Always preview on mobile—its connected letters should remain distinct, not blur together.

In print projects, consider paper texture. Ralitta gains extra depth on uncoated or cotton-fiber stock—the slight tooth of the surface echoes the tactile quality of ink on paper. For foil-stamped wedding invitations, its clean lines translate cleanly into metallic finishes without thin strokes disappearing.

For branding systems, treat Ralitta as a voice—not the whole vocabulary. Use it only for the brand name or tagline, then switch to a supporting typeface for all other copy. This preserves its impact and ensures scalability across apps, signage, and merch.

Keeping Your Work Original and Audience-Focused

Using Ralitta doesn’t mean copying trends—it means choosing tools that serve your message and your people. Ask yourself before applying it:

  1. Does this usage reflect how my audience actually communicates? (e.g., A law firm’s “About Us” page may benefit more from clarity than charm.)
  2. Is the tone I’m aiming for aligned with Ralitta’s natural voice—warm, poised, unhurried?
  3. Will this choice make the information easier to find, remember, or trust—or does it add friction?

When used thoughtfully, Ralitta becomes part of a larger strategy—not decoration, but intention made visible. A handwritten logo for a yoga studio says “mindful presence.” Ralitta on a teacher’s welcome sign says “you belong here.” On a small-batch candle label, it whispers “made with attention.” These aren’t vague feelings—they’re specific, audience-centered signals built on typographic discipline.
